Hello all.

ive got 2016 macan with the daytime running lights underneath. not the 4 spots. I noticed today as my wife drove off from the drive that the DRL were not on but the smaller bulbs above were. Do the DRL switch off in certain conditions? It was not dark but a wet dull day. Lights switch set to AUTO.
Thanks

 
It is my understanding that the DRL's will remain on all the time, even if the light switch is in the 'OFF' position the DRL's should come on when the ignition is turned on. The DRL's will however go off if the side lights are on which it sounds like they were in this case. Nothing to worry about I don't think. Look at page 150 of the manual.
